Just a quick update on this thread as it comes up to it's third anniversary. The Westerly Tiger we looked at is STILL on brokerage unsold. We calculate that with mooring fees, cleaning, haul outs/ins and winter storage costs since it first went up for sale well over 5 years ago, that it's cost the owner more than the price of the boat. She's never moved off her mooring and is hardly visited.
